1. What Are Steroid Injections?
Steroid injections are typically anabolic steroids, synthetic substances similar to the male sex hormone testosterone. They are used to promote muscle growth, increase strength, and improve overall athletic performance.

3. Risks and Side Effects
Despite their potential advantages, steroid injections come with a range of risks and side effects that bodybuilders should consider:
- Hormonal imbalances leading to conditions such as gynecomastia (breast tissue development in men).
- Cardiovascular issues, including an increased risk of heart attack and stroke.
- Liver damage and other organ dysfunctions.
- Psychological effects such as aggression, mood swings, and depression.
